
Dozens of Palestinians were martyred and injured in massacres carried out by the Israeli occupation army, targeting civilians, the majority of whom were children and women, in the city of Khan Yunis and various regions of the Gaza Strip, for the 109th consecutive day of the deadly Israeli aggression.
The Israeli war transformed the night of the Gazans into double terror, while the flare bombs fired by the occupation forces intensely ignited the sky of the stricken Strip.
Last night, the occupation army continued to carry out its crimes and kill more civilians, as the Palestinian Red Crescent reported, at dawn on Tuesday, that “the occupation targeted the fourth floor of the association’s headquarters in Khan Yunis with artillery shelling, coinciding with heavy gunfire from Israeli marches, which led to a number of casualties among the displaced.
A number of casualties arrived at hospitals in the city of Rafah, at dawn, as a result of an Israeli bombing that targeted the Mawasi area in the city of Khan Yunis, which is witnessing intense bombardment and where the occupation’s aggression is concentrated.
Palestinian sources also reported that the east of the Al-Masdar area in the central Gaza Strip was targeted by Israeli artillery shelling.
Martyrs and wounded arrived at Al-Aqsa Hospital as a result of an Israeli bombing that targeted a displaced person’s car coming from Khan Yunis to the Central Governorate of Gaza. Casualties also arrived at Abu Youssef Al-Najjar Hospital in Rafah, as a result of an Israeli bombing that targeted the tents of displaced people in the Al-Mawasi area, south of the Gaza Strip.
The Gaza Civil Defense announced that its crews were able to recover a seriously injured person as a result of the occupation aircraft targeting a house in Beit Lahia in the northern Gaza Strip.
In addition, the occupation forces continued artillery shelling for hours this morning on citizens’ homes on Street 8, south of Gaza City.
The occupation forces booby-trapped and blew up a number of citizens' homes in the Sheikh Ajlin area, west of Gaza.
The occupation army fired flares extensively in the airspace of the western areas of the city of Khan Yunis last night.
In turn, the Palestinian Red Crescent said, “Ambulance crews are facing great difficulty in reaching the wounded as a result of the continuous bombing on Khan Yunis.”
In its latest update, the Palestinian Ministry of Health announced that the toll of the Israeli aggression had risen to 25,295 martyrs, in addition to 63,000 wounded since October 7, 2023.
